The Unfortunate Reality of Many DME Workflows

Many DME workflows we encounter are built around manual tasks. Unfortunately, manual DME tasks are error-prone and time-consuming, even with the best team.

When we talk to DMEs with entirely manual workflows, we often hear about these pain points:

  • Endless faxing and phone calls
  • Chasing down documentation
  • Human error in data entry
  • Claim denials from missing info
  • Delayed reimbursements
  • Compliance risks

Key DME Workflow Elements:

Automation can touch every element of the DME workflow for the better. At DME Flow, we’ve even seen automation transform key elements of the workflow into nearly touchless processes.

Consider, for example, the possible ways automation could impact these steps in YOUR DME workflow:

  1. Intake – Smart forms, digital signatures, automated reminders
  2. Documentation – Auto-document fetching, integration with EMR
  3. Insurance Verification – Real-time API-based checks
  4. Prior Authorizations – Automated submission and status tracking
  5. Order Fulfillment – Auto-routing to inventory/shipping
  6. Billing & Claims – Clean claim generation + integrated clearinghouse
  7. Audit Prep – Auto-generated documentation bundles
